Alert: the static-analysis baseline file for the Corvalen repository has drifted out of sync with the current scan results. This usually means a developer merged code with new findings without regenerating the baseline, so the nightly scan is now flagging pre-existing issues as new. Support should not advise customers to suppress these findings manually. Instead, confirm the baseline commit hash, then regenerate using the documented procedure. Step-by-step instructions and escalation criteria are maintained on the internal page below.

operations page: https://jenkins.zemvarcloud.local/job/merge_requests/repo/build/73930b4b30f0a8ed

# Break-Glass: Catalog Cache Invalidation

Scope: the Pinrow product catalog at Veldstone Retail. If stale prices persist after a purge and the Hollowmere invalidation queue is wedged, use break-glass to flush the edge tier directly. Contractors: get verbal sign-off from the catalog lead first. Steps: open the Hollowmere admin shell, select emergency-flush, confirm the tenant, and run it once — repeated flushes thrash the origin. Access is logged and expires after 20 minutes. Unseal the admin shell with the passphrase below.

recovery phrase for kahop-tajog: istix-casvan

## Formula sandbox tuning

User-supplied formulas in Gridmoor execute inside a restricted interpreter with hard ceilings on time, memory, and call depth. Reviewers should confirm any change to these ceilings is justified in the PR description, since raising them widens the abuse surface. Defaults were chosen from production traces. The current limits are as follows.

limits module of tafog-fawip:
WEIGHTS = {
    "julix": 57,
    "lamys": 992,
    "kasvan": 209,
    "quenok": 750,
    "alddor": 259,
    "oliath": 1009,
    "wenix": 815,
}

## Who to ping about GiftNote

Welcome aboard! GiftNote is our donation-receipt mailer for the Larchfield Fund. Template tweaks go to the comms folks; delivery failures and bounce weirdness go to the platform crew. Don't push template changes on Fridays — receipts batch over the weekend. For anything GiftNote-related, start with the address below.

billing contact of kaweg-tajeg = drudor.lamion.oliath@torvalabs.test